Abstract:Objective To understand the significance of the actions developed by the nursing team in a Psychiatric Inpatient Unit for adolescent female users of psychoactive substances in the light of Alfred Schutz’s phenomenological sociology framework. Method Qualitative study with Alfred Schutz’s Phenomenological Sociology approach.
